What is the purpose of lubricants in worm gears?

Explanation:
Lubricants in worm gear systems primarily create a protective film between the worm and the worm wheel. This film reduces sliding friction at the contact surfaces, which in turn lowers wear and minimizes surface damage like pitting or scoring. The sliding action in worm gear contacts generates a lot of heat, so the lubricant also helps carry away that heat to keep temperatures in a safe range. In addition, lubrication helps protect against corrosion and can help trap and carry away debris.
